I had lysis of adhesions and a right ovary, cyst, and tube removal as well. To my dismay, I noticed I had numbness in my left anterior hip, thigh, groin, and right lateral hip. Will be 2 months the 19th since I’ve had it. My insurance company denied me a MRI so we are doing PT and nerve conduction test on my left leg. Why only the left I don’t know! The numbness is basically in patches… It feels really weird. I do have a long history of back problems though….. Comments
